How Examination Type is Determined?

Patient > Clinical > Order & Results> Physical Exam

The examination type is determined by the information documented in the Physical Exam component.

There are four types of examination:

Problem focused: A limited examination of the affected body area or organ system.

Expanded Problem Focused: A limited examination of the affected body area or organ system and any other symptomatic or related body area(s) or organ system(s).

Detailed: An extended examination of the affected body area(s) or organ system(s) and any other symptomatic or related body area(s) or organ system(s).

Comprehensive: A general multi-system examination or complete examination of a single organ system and other symptomatic or related body area(s) or organ system(s).
